
Kodak Double-X #7222 - 400ft 16mm Film
All of our 16mm film is brand new stock, fresh from Kodak.
KODAK DOUBLE-X Black & White Negative Film is designed for production use in dim light ā outdoors and in the studio ā and anywhere you need greater depth of field without increased illumination.
ā 400ft reel in sealed can.
ā Single perforation,Ā Type-T Core.
ā Fine grain and high sharpness
ā Panchromatic B&W negative movie film.
ā For full technical data, see Kodak documents here.
All of our Cine Film is kept cold-stored before being shipped out direct to you.
Store your 16mm film in a cool, dark place under 13°.
If storing for more than 6 months, Kodak recommend sealing in an airtight sealed bag and freezing.
